Cole Kmet (TE, CHI) - Fantasy Football Week 13 Waiver Wire Pickups

Cole Kmet - Fantasy Football Rankings, Draft Sleepers, NFL injury News

Cole Kmet is a fantasy football waiver wire pickup option for tight ends. Target him as a free agent add off waivers for Week 13 of the 2021 NFL season.

BALLER MOVE: Add in 14+ Team Leagues

ROSTERED IN: 24% of Leagues

ANALYSIS: There is a thing about Chicago and it is that the Bears have pretty much sucked for most of the season. Not happy enough with the start to their campaign, Chicago moved on from veteran Andy Dalton to rookie Justin Fields at the quarterback position, discovered a young man going through heavy growing pains but still outperforming Dalton, lost Fields to injury, and had to endure Dalton for another week last Thanksgiving Thursday. Immune to the quarterback change, though, was tight end Cole Kmet, who actually enjoyed Dalton's presence on the field.

Kmet had a rough start to the year other than for his Week 1 outing--a TE17, 9.2 PPR point performance against the Rams. Kmet finished that game with a 7-5-42 receiving line, but he went on to have three consecutive subpar games to the tune of 2.1 PPR points at most. The snap share, though, has stayed at 77%+ or higher from Week 3 on and Kmet has finally been able to find his mojo of late. The Week 5-to-8 span wasn't bad (average 7.0 FPPG goof for two TE2 finishes and two more inside the TE3 realm) but the last three weeks are what are pointing in an absolutely beautiful direction for Kmet.

Back in Week 9, Kmet hit double-digit PPR points for the first time this season with an 8-6-87 line for 14.7 fantasy points, and just last Thursday he mimicked that production with an even bulkier 11-8-65 line translating to 14.5 PPR points and another TE1 finish on the week. Kmet has had his fair share of duds this season, yes, but he's finally gearing up and playing to reasonable TE2 levels with upside for more ROS. Not the worst option to stream and much less to roster and start weekly by those on deeper leagues.
